Elsa Keslassy International CorrespondentOscar-nominated Danish director Lone Scherfig (“An Education”) will be making her return to television with “The Shift,” an emotional series set in a contemporary maternity ward headlined by Danish star Sofie Gråbøl (“The Killing,” “The Undoing”). The prestige eight-part series starts shooting this week, it has been commissioned by Danish commercial channel TV2 and TV2 Play, and is being represented in international markets by Beta Film.

Cambridge ‘Pink Floyd’ pub and grassroots venue set for demolition

Pink Floyd is to be demolished after a decade spent fighting redevelopment plans.The Flying Pig in Cambridge was regularly visited by the band’s original frontman Syd Barrett. It is said to be the place where he first met future Pink Floyd guitarist and co-lead vocalist David Gilmour, when it was named The Crown in the late 1950s.The pub’s managers Matt and Justine Hatfield said they have been given six months to vacate the property.

Paramount TV Chief Nicole Clemens Set to Take on Key Content Role at Paramount+

Paramount TV Studios president Nicole Clemens is set to assume a bigger role at Paramount+. Clemens is in discussions to take over some of the duties left by outgoing head of programming Julie McNamara, an individual with knowledge of the situation told TheWrap.Clemens, whose new role is not yet official, would not have the exact same role and title as McNamara.
